Skip to main content

Documentation Index

Fetch the complete documentation index at: https://sailia-mintlify-activity-passes-family-1776854733.mintlify.app/llms.txt

Use this file to discover all available pages before exploring further.

All bookings — whether made online, through the point of sale, via the Adventuro marketplace, or the API — flow into a single bookings dashboard. From here you can track every reservation, update attendee details, process cancellations, and monitor payment status.

Bookings dashboard

The bookings dashboard gives you a unified view of all reservations. You can filter by:
  • Date range — view bookings for a specific day, week, or custom period
  • Activity — narrow down to a specific course, hire, or event
  • Status — filter by confirmed, pending, cancelled, or waitlisted
  • Payment status — find bookings that are paid, partially paid, or unpaid
Each booking entry shows the customer name, activity, session date and time, number of attendees, and payment status at a glance.

Schedule filters

The schedule view provides a set of filters to help you quickly find specific sessions. Filters can be combined and are preserved as you navigate between dates.
FilterDescription
SearchFree-text search across session names and details
Places bookedRange filter to show only sessions within a minimum and maximum number of booked places
TypeToggle visibility of session types — Course, Hire, Overnight, Event, or Availability
LocationFilter by location when you have more than one site configured
ActivityMulti-select filter listing every course and hire activity in your schedule
Staff countRange filter to show sessions by the number of assigned staff members
Waitlist sizeRange filter to show sessions by the number of customers on the waitlist
Select Clear all to reset every active filter at once. The button shows a count of how many filters are currently applied.
Filter selections persist when you switch between the overview and staff schedule views. Switching to the register view temporarily clears filters, but your previous selections are restored when you return.

Booking details

Open any booking to see the full details:
FieldDescription
CustomerThe customer’s name, email, and account details
ActivityThe booked activity, session date, and time slot
AttendeesNames and details of all participants
PaymentPayment method, amount, and status
Add-onsAny optional extras included in the booking
WaiversCompletion status of any required waivers
DiscountAny discount codes or membership discounts applied

Edit a booking

From the booking details, you can:
  • Add or remove attendees — adjust the number of participants on a session
  • Change the session — move a booking to a different date or time slot (subject to availability)
  • Update attendee details — correct names, contact information, or custom field responses
  • Add notes — attach internal notes visible only to your team
Changes to a booking do not automatically trigger a notification to the customer. Use workflows to set up automated update emails, or resend the confirmation manually from the order receipt.

Cancel a booking

To cancel a booking:
  1. Open the booking from your dashboard.
  2. Select Cancel.
  3. Choose whether to process a refund — full, partial, or none.
  4. Confirm the cancellation.
Cancelled bookings free up the session capacity immediately. If a waitlist exists for the session, the next customer is notified automatically.

Resend confirmation emails

You can resend booking confirmation emails to any email address directly from the order receipt. This is useful when a customer did not receive the original email, when you need to forward the details to a different address, or when you have updated a booking and want the customer to receive an updated confirmation. To resend a confirmation:
  1. Open the order receipt from the bookings dashboard.
  2. Scroll to the Emails sent to this account section.
  3. Click Send confirmation email.
  4. Enter the recipient’s email address.
  5. Click Send.
The confirmation email includes the current booking details and a PDF receipt attachment. If the booking has been modified since the original confirmation, the resent email reflects the latest information.
The Send confirmation email button is available to staff with the View Other User Profiles permission. It appears on all completed orders, including those linked to customer accounts and guest checkouts.

Booking sources

Each booking is tagged with its source so you can understand where your reservations come from:
SourceDescription
OnlineBooked through your online booking page
POSCreated through the point of sale
AdventuroBooked through the Adventuro marketplace
APICreated programmatically through the Sailia API

Online bookings

How customers book through your online booking page.

Payments and Stripe

Process refunds and manage payment status.